Transaction 37b568bf986249787f713272c528f08e521360b42c85073c4b9660c2b55347b5
1 Input
2 Outputs
- 37b568bf986249787f713272c528f08e521360b42c85073c4b9660c2b55347b5:0
- 37b568bf986249787f713272c528f08e521360b42c85073c4b9660c2b55347b5:1
value 6201400
address 17L45HrsxkokbXBHFt48DFUve9grTKBoRi
value 21869224
address 38r979eQYHmbVRBY1KF71BzNCmthtC6xDR